@TheStraightestWhitest 8 ай бұрын
I said it was his only chance. Izzy does not function well under pressure. He relies on leg kicks to slow people down so they can't pressure him, and if you don't check those (Costa), you will eventually be forced to play his game. Izzy also doesn't fight well against men his height. Jan and Strickland are 6'2. Izzy is 6'3. The difference is too small for him to get away with his usual stylebending, which is basically just him finding awkward angles during a leanback to land hooks against shorter opponents. It's how he KO'd Rob and knocked down Gastelum. But he tried it against Strickland, and it didn't work, in fact he got countered, once in Rd2, once in Rd2, after which he stopped trying. Once he stopped trying, it was all over for him. Mind you, I'm not claiming to be a prophet. I didn't think Strickland would win as he can be a bit slow and doesn't have an insane chin. I figured he'd just kinda stand there the way he usually does and get picked off. But he clearly knew what Izzy's weakness was, which is pressure, and he exploited it masterfully.
